Historical & Cultural Background
The name Nijal has roots in both Arabic and Indian cultures. In Arabic-speaking regions, it is often associated with the concept of a gift or blessing. In India, it may reflect a sense of value and preciousness. The name is relatively uncommon, which may appeal to parents seeking unique names for their children.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Nijal was first seen in the United States in 1993. Nijal has ranked as high as #1339 nationally, which occurred in 2011, and has been most popular in . In the past 5 years the name Nijal has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
